Understanding historical data in Arkansas
Historical data forms are essential tools for documenting and preserving pivotal moments in history. In Arkansas, these forms serve multiple purposes, including vital record keeping, legal documentation, and property ownership verification. They provide a tangible connection to the past and are fundamental for individual and governmental functions.
These forms capture various types of historical events and demographics, from births to marriages to property ownership transfers. The legal context governing these data forms is crucial, with the State of Arkansas implementing specific regulations to maintain accuracy and protect citizens' rights. Understanding these laws is vital for anyone seeking to access or utilize these documents.

Accessing historical data forms
Accessing historical data forms in Arkansas is more straightforward now than ever, thanks to digitization and online resources. There are numerous platforms, including state-run websites, where you can find many forms you need.
Local government offices and archives remain invaluable resources, often housing additional historical documents not yet available online. However, to access these records, it's important to understand any attached fees and requirements. Many forms may require identification or proof of relation, especially when requesting sensitive records like vital statistics.
